Does Giant Accept EBT Cards?

Yes, Giant Food Stores, including all of their locations, accept EBT cards for eligible food purchases. This means you can use your benefits to buy groceries at any Giant store, just like you would with a debit or credit card.

What Can You Buy with EBT at Giant?

Knowing what you *can* buy with your EBT card is super important! EBT benefits are mainly for buying food items. Giant follows the rules set by the USDA (United States Department of Agriculture), which oversees the SNAP (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program), the program that provides EBT benefits.

Generally, you can use your EBT card to buy:

  • Fruits and vegetables
  • Meat, poultry, and fish
  • Dairy products
  • Breads and cereals
  • Snack foods (chips, cookies, etc.)
  • Non-alcoholic beverages

But be careful! There are things you *can’t* buy. Items like alcohol, tobacco products, and household supplies aren’t covered by EBT. Always double-check if you are unsure!

How to Pay with EBT at Giant

Paying with your EBT card at Giant is simple. When you’re ready to check out, the cashier will ask how you’d like to pay. Just let them know you’ll be using your EBT card.

You’ll need to swipe your card and enter your PIN (Personal Identification Number), just like with a regular debit card. The amount for your eligible food purchases will be deducted from your EBT balance. Any items that aren’t EBT-eligible (like paper towels or soap) will need to be paid for using another payment method, such as cash, a debit card, or a credit card.

Here’s a little breakdown of the process:

  1. Gather your groceries.
  2. Go to the checkout lane.
  3. Place your groceries on the conveyor belt.
  4. Tell the cashier you’re using EBT.
  5. Swipe your card and enter your PIN.
  6. Pay for non-EBT items separately.
  7. Get your receipt and go!

Using EBT for Online Orders and Delivery at Giant

Good news! Giant often lets you use your EBT card for online orders, but it’s not always the same as in-store. This can really help if you want to shop from home.

First, check the Giant website or app. They will have details on the EBT payment process. You usually need to link your EBT card to your online account. Then, when you check out, you can select EBT as your payment method.

  • Some stores might let you use EBT for home delivery, but this depends on your location and the delivery service.
  • You might also be able to use EBT for pickup orders.
  • Make sure to review Giant’s specific policies on their website or app.

Remember that online orders can sometimes have extra fees, like a delivery charge. Be sure to look at those fees before you complete your purchase!

What Happens if Your EBT Card is Declined at Giant?

If your EBT card is declined at Giant, don’t panic! There are a few reasons why this might happen. The most common reasons are insufficient funds, an incorrect PIN, or a problem with the card itself.

First, double-check your EBT balance. You can usually do this by looking at your most recent receipt, using an app (if your state offers one), or calling the number on the back of your card. Make sure you have enough money to cover your purchases.

If your card is still declined, here’s what you can do:

  1. Make sure you are entering the correct PIN.
  2. Check to make sure you are only purchasing eligible items.
  3. Check the card for any damage.
  4. Call the EBT customer service number (on the back of your card) to find out more.

If the problem isn’t clear, the cashier can’t tell you why. You may need to try another form of payment or put some items back.
